In the Salt Lake City, UT area, assisted living typically runs $3,820–$5,980/month (median $4,780), memory care $3,920–$6,130/month (median $4,900), and skilled nursing $8,100–$11,950/month (median $9,700) — local estimates built from published survey medians adjusted for area prices. Every skilled nursing community is scored with our Haven Scout Score, a composite built from official CMS Care Compare data — overall star rating, health inspections, staffing levels, and quality measures — plus safety signals like fines and citation history. Assisted living helps with daily activities while preserving independence. Memory care is a secured setting with specially trained staff for dementia. Skilled nursing provides 24/7 licensed medical care and rehab. Not sure which fits? Take our free 2-minute care assessment.
